How they compare
French Polynesia currently reports 198,162 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re against 3,189 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re in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income), a difference of 194,973 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re.
That makes French Polynesia's figure about 62.1 times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income)'s.
Across all 39 years both countries report, French Polynesia has been ahead every year.
French Polynesia ranks 6th and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income) ranks 9th of 178 countries.
French Polynesia has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.

About this data
Net official development assistance and official aid received (constant 2023 US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
